John Stewart Woodruff 1907–1997 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 12 Aug 1907

Birth Location: Chicago, Cook, Illinois

Death Date: 13 Feb 1997

Death Location: Collier, Florida, United States

Father: John Woodruff

Mother: Maude Stewart

Spouse(s): Helen Lott

Children(s): John Woodruff, Nancy Woodruff

The story of John Stewart Woodruff began in 1907 in Chicago, Cook, Illinois. In 1910, John Stewart Woodruff resided in Chicago Ward 7, Cook, Illinois, USA. In 1920, John Stewart Woodruff resided in Chicago Ward 7, Cook (Chicago), Illinois, USA. John Stewart Woodruff married Helen Louise Lott, and had children including John Stewart Woodruff, Nancy Lott Woodruff, Tom B Woodruff. John Stewart Woodruff passed away in 1997 in Collier, Florida, United States.
